Dr. Rodney Rock is an Instructor of Educational Leadership. Dr. Rock has a long and distinguished career as a teacher (6 years), elementary school principal (7 years), county curriculum director (4 years), as an award winning superintendent of schools (8years), and as an associate professor of Educational Leadership (2 years). His dissertation received the Central Michigan University Dissertation of the Year Award in 2006. Dr. Rock is a local, state, national, and international presenter. He has completed certificate programs in Positive Psychology and College Teaching and Learning.
